The Function of Air Filters in Vehicles
Air filters play a critical role in your vehicle's performance and longevity. They prevent dirt, dust, and debris from entering the engine and help maintain clean airflow, which is essential for optimal combustion.
Types of Air Filters
There are several types of air filters, including engine air filters and cabin air filters. Engine air filters keep contaminants out of the engine, while cabin air filters improve the quality of air inside the vehicle.
Signs You Need to Change Your Air Filter
Common signs that your air filter may need replacement include decreased fuel efficiency, unusual engine performance, and foul odors in the cabin. Regular inspections can help identify these issues early.
How to Maintain Your Air Filters
Keeping your air filters clean is essential for vehicle performance. Regularly check and replace engine air filters as per manufacturer recommendations. Cabin air filters should also be replaced to ensure clean air inside the vehicle.
Impact of Clean Filters on Performance
A clean air filter not only improves engine efficiency but also enhances fuel economy and reduces harmful emissions. This leads to a better driving experience and a reduced environmental footprint.
